How To Make Pizza Rolls In Air Fryer
- Get ready to enjoy delicious pizza rolls! Preheat your air fryer, then place them in a single layer. Don't forget to set the temperature at 380 degrees. That way, they become wonderfully crispy and taste just right.
- Whip up your favorite dish and cook it to perfection! Flip it halfway through cooking for 6-8 minutes, then let the deliciousness sit so that melty mozzarella cheese has time to settle. Enjoy your tasty creation in no time! Pizza rolls explode because the liquids inside begin to boil and expand.
- Transform your dinner into a tasty pizza feast! Top with Parmesan cheese and serve some yummy pizza sauce for the ultimate Italian-style meal. Bon Appétit!
- There is really no need to thaw before air-frying pizza rolls.

Tips
- Want perfectly crispy pizza rolls? Make sure they're spread evenly in a single layer! Too many close together won't get the crunch you’re looking for. If you want to make more than 20, break it into batches and enjoy that deliciousness all night! Keep air-fried pizza rolls frozen until ready to use.
- No need to worry about extra cooking spray - the air fryer gives your food a delicious, perfectly crispy texture. But if you're looking for an extra crunchy bite, give them a quick cooking spray!
- Having trouble getting that delicious dinner off of your air fryer's tray? Don't worry; it happens to everyone! To ensure nothing sticks, try a few nifty tips - lining the basket with parchment paper before you start cooking will give things extra slippery protection. Or spraying an "air-fryer-safe" cooking spray there could do wonders too. If all else fails, shake up those pizza rolls halfway through and they should turn out fine.
- No need to stress if you have an unexpected pizza roll explosion - that's a great sign they are ready! For those who prefer slightly less done, pull them out when the outer layer gets crispy. With these pointers, it'll be more accessible than ever to cook up perfect pizza rolls every time!

How many pizza rolls can you load in the air fryer basket?
It depends on the size of your air fryer and the size of the pizza rolls. Generally, most air fryers have a capacity of 2.5 to 3 liters, so you may be able to fit around 30-35 standard-sized pizza rolls in an average basket. This number can change based on whether you are using medium or large sized pizza rolls as well as depending on how much space they take up when arranged in the basket.
For best results, it is recommended that you evenly spread out your pizza rolls within the air fryer basket and do not overcrowd them with each other. This will help ensure that all of your pizza rolls cook thoroughly and evenly without having any cold spots or overcooked areas.
You should also make sure there is enough room for proper airflow around each individual roll so that heat can reach all sides equally and not just one side at a time which could cause uneven cooking or burning on one side.
